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ria
- •Inclusion criteria for womens: Nullipar of; Pre\-test score of less than 9; The absence of abnormalities in the fetus; Gestational age of 34 weeks; Lack of depression known; Failure stressful event in the past 6 months
- •Inclusion criteria for men :Lack of drug addiction; have a job; Lack of depression known
- •Exclusion criteria:Non\-attending counseling; Abnormalities in the baby or infant death; Maternal and child needs special care after birth
